How much do trainee civil structural engineer j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for trainee civil structural engineer in Atlanta, GA is $68,623.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$60,600.00 and $70,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er, you need a solid understanding of engineering principles, mathematics, and materials science, typically supported by a relevant degree or ongoing studies in civil or structural engineering. Familiarity with design software such as AutoCAD, Revit, and structural analysis tools, as well as knowledge of industry standards, is highly beneficial. Strong attention to detail, teamwork, and effective communication are essential soft skills that help in collaborating with multidisciplinary teams and interpreting technical information. These combined skills ensure safe, efficient, and innovative structural solutions while supporting career growth and successful project outcomes.

What types of projects and tasks can a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er expect to be involved in during the first year?

As a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er, you will typically assist with a variety of tasks, including preparing technical drawings, performing basic structural calculations, and supporting site inspections. You may be involved in designing elements of new buildings, bridges, or other infrastructure, while learning to use industry-standard software such as AutoCAD and Revit. Collaboration with senior engineers, architects, and construction teams is common, providing valuable exposure to multidisciplinary project workflows. This hands-on experience helps you build a solid foundation in both office-based design and on-site engineering practices.

What does a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er do?

A Trainee Civil Structural Engineer assists experienced engineers in designing, analyzing, and supervising the construction of structures like buildings, bridges, and tunnels. Their responsibilities often include preparing technical drawings, conducting site inspections, performing calculations, and learning to use engineering software. Trainees gain practical experience while working on real projects, helping ensure structures are safe, stable, and built to standards. This role is crucial for developing the skills and knowledge needed to become a fully qualified structural engineer.

What is the difference between Trainee Civil Structural Engineer vs Civil Structural Engineer?

AspectTrainee Civil Structural EngineerCivil Structural Engineer
QualificationsTypically pursuing or recently completed a degree in civil or structural engineeringRegistered or licensed engineer with full professional credentials
Work ExperienceLimited, often entry-level or internship-basedSeveral years of relevant experience in structural design and analysis
ResponsibilitiesAssisting in design, calculations, and project support under supervisionLeading design projects, overseeing calculations, and client communication
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, design offices, under supervisionDesign offices, project sites, client meetings

In summary, a Trainee Civil Structural Engineer is an entry-level role focused on learning and assisting, while a Civil Structural Engineer is a fully qualified professional responsible for leading projects and making critical design decisions.

Job description

ESiโ€™s Civil Structural Practice Group is looking for a civil / structural engineer that is responsible for managing consulting projects and performing engineering tasks related to construction defects and building damage from natural hazards (e.g., wind, water, and hail). Tasks include performing consulting and loss investigations, site inspections, engineering analyses, and engineering calculations. Work product includes presenting findings in the form of technical reports, delivering findings via conference call or presentations, developing exhibits, and providing sworn oral testimony. This position is targeted as a Senior Consultant. However, if a candidate has greater experience, we will consider hiring at a Senior Managing Consultant level or higher if the candidate has an established book of clients.
